What family members face when a loved one has a brain injury

Carolyn Gan, from Toronto, is an accomplished family therapist and expert in helping people with brain injuries and their families pick up the pieces of their lives. In a short video available on BrainLine.org and YouTube, Ms. Gan talks to families about personality and behavior changes experienced by the person and the effects of what…

Brainline Interviews Ron Broughton: Patients with TBI need to be true partners in their treatment

Brainline.org is a resource, a place of support and information, for anyone who deals with brain injury from the individuals with brain injury to their families as well as professionals working within the field.  It is part of WETA which is the public television and radio station in Washington, D.C.  Brainline has interviewed the Chief…
